Rucoletta is a fantastic little Italian spot tucked just behind St Paul’s Cathedral. I went in without much expectation and left genuinely impressed. The atmosphere is cozy and inviting, and the staff are super friendly and attentive. I had a prawn pasta dish (can’t remember the exact name!) — it came with giant, juicy prawns in a beautifully balanced, light sauce. The pasta was perfectly cooked and soaked up the flavours so well. You could tell the ingredients were really fresh. It was one of those dishes you don’t want to end. The service was quick even though the place was quite busy. The warm bread with olive oil they bring out is a nice touch, and overall, the prices are very fair for central London — especially for the quality you’re getting. It’s one of those rare places that feels like a local secret. No gimmicks, just really good food and genuine hospitality. Highly recommend if you’re in the area and craving proper Italian!

Had nicely cooked pasta that was flavorful. That was the only high-ish point. Service was below average. There is no "tending" to the customer. They want this to be like cafeteria service in terms of time/effort invested by waitstaff yet somehow feel justified in assessing a 13.5% service charge. Had to flag down waiter to ask for everything as he didn't bother to check in once, even after our dinners were dropped off. Ordered two large pours of wine but got just an average pour (based on our observations of other glasses we watched being poured as we were seated near the bar). Couldn't locate our waiter to ask him to check on this. We were finally able to flag him down to get our bill. Somehow it didn't seem surprising that we were charged for an extra bottle of sparkling water. Sorting this out took more time as, again, our waiter seemed to vanish. Who handles the training at this place? Can't imagine it will last long with service like this. No one wants to pay to be ignored.
